Did Amerindians or Pacific Islanders Voyage Long Distances to and from the Americas Before 1492?

Ideas about pre-Columbian trans-Pacific contact between Oceania and the Americas have captured the attention of both scholars and the general public since the sixteenth century. During this century, Europeans sought to discover, and later colonise the then unknown islands in the Pacific. Early European encounters with Amerindians bolstered attempts to comprehend the whereabouts of their origins, some of which were placed in, or involved the Pacific Ocean.
